Transaction 8862d7662d3a92bac57b94bc91bb720491b437e25a9fde1c53a1c9ce86384e9c

1 Input
2 Outputs
  • 8862d7662d3a92bac57b94bc91bb720491b437e25a9fde1c53a1c9ce86384e9c:0
  • value  439337
    address  1Dzz8ndqXfbAmF5soWuFKpb2ozUrkVKpLV
  • 8862d7662d3a92bac57b94bc91bb720491b437e25a9fde1c53a1c9ce86384e9c:1
  • value  183445084
    address  1MuL4mu4MfP6ENrEZ668ft7tgiAapGXShK